Helping you get down the mountain...

History tells us that 282 people died on Mount Everest between 1924 and June 2016. Of those deaths, 70 died coming down from the summit. In other words, 25% of those that died, did so on the way down. They met with some measure of success, but ultimately failed. That of course is assuming the goal was to get to the summit and back down.
